There is something sacred in the stillness, in the moments when you sit quietly with your herbs, feeling the energy of each plant before the blending begins. As you hold them in your hands, consider how they work together, forming a synergy greater than the sum of their parts. The peppermint leaf cools and invigorates, the tulsi grounds and nurtures, the rosehips offer their vibrant support. Each herb holds its own story, its own gift, waiting for you to discover how it can help you and your loved ones.
In this moment of connection, you are not just preparing a tea or an oil, you are crafting something imbued with your intention. Like the weaving of threads into a tapestry, your thoughts, your gratitude, and your focus become part of the blend itself. What do you wish for this creation? Is it healing, peace, protection, or maybe a sense of empowerment? Hold that thought as you gather the herbs, and feel it flow into your work.
Much like the energy we put into our daily lives, the thoughts and emotions we pour into our creations ripple outward. This is the essence of energy—our ability to infuse our intentions into what we touch. The same way a day begun with gratitude feels lighter and more joyful, a blend crafted with purpose becomes more than just the sum of its parts.
Perhaps you’re making an herbal vinegar for the kitchen—apple cider vinegar mingled with rosemary and thyme for immune support, or an oil infused with plantain and calendula to soothe the skin. As you prepare, know that your energy, your hopes for the people who will use it, and your reverence for the plants themselves add to the effectiveness. It is no different than when you send love and well-wishes into the world, knowing that those feelings create ripples, bringing their own kind of magic.
Blending herbs is both an art and a ritual. It’s not just about knowing which plants complement one another, but about feeling the energy that you, the creator, bring to the process. In these moments of intentional creation, you craft not just with your hands but with your heart, your mind, and your spirit. The result? A tea, oil, or tincture that carries the magic of intention into every sip, drop, and dose.
